>From a reply sent to me by National Public Radio's "Talk of The Nation":

AUGUST 21 THE CATCHER IN THE RYE BY J.D. SALINGER

The hero-narrator of this novel, 16-year old school boy Holden
Caulfield,
is in rebellion against the dubious values of the adult world. He
leaves his
sheltered prep school in Pennsylvania and takes us on a journey to New
York
City. _The Catcher in the Rye_ is a psychological portrait and a comic
novel
of a boy frightened at the prospect of growing up, a boy who has few of
the
skills necessary to face the world on his own.
